What Is Graston Technique®?

Graston Technique® is an advanced form of Instrument-Assisted Soft Tissue Mobilization (IASTM) that uses specially designed stainless-steel instruments to detect and treat restrictions in muscles, tendons, ligaments, fascia, and scar tissue.

The instruments allow your therapist to identify areas of abnormal tissue that may not be easily detected by hands alone. Gentle, controlled strokes help break down scar tissue and adhesions while stimulating the body’s natural healing process.

How Does It Work?

Injuries, repetitive movements, surgery, or poor posture can cause scar tissue and soft tissue restrictions to develop. These restrictions may lead to:

  • Pain
  • Stiffness
  • Reduced flexibility
  • Limited joint motion
  • Muscle weakness
  • Decreased athletic performance

Graston Technique® helps restore normal tissue mobility by:

  • Breaking down scar tissue and adhesions
  • Improving blood flow and circulation
  • Stimulating tissue remodeling
  • Reducing inflammation
  • Increasing flexibility
  • Improving range of motion
  • Decreasing pain
  • Restoring normal movement patterns

What Does Treatment Feel Like?

During treatment, your therapist glides the specialized instruments over the affected tissues to identify areas of restriction. You may feel mild discomfort over tight or scarred tissue, but treatment is adjusted to your tolerance.

Many patients notice:

  • Reduced pain
  • Improved flexibility
  • Increased mobility
  • Easier movement
  • Improved function

after just a few treatments.

Some temporary soreness or mild bruising may occur and usually resolves within a few days.
